linux查看挂载命令df
-
要查看Linux系统中挂载的文件系统及其使用情况,可以使用df命令。df是disk free的缩写,用于显示磁盘空间的使用情况。
使用df命令的一般格式如下:
“`
df [选项] [文件或目录]
“`其中,选项可以有以下常用的参数:
– -h:以人类可读的方式显示磁盘空间信息,以适合人类阅读的单位(如GB、MB等)显示;
– -T:显示文件系统的类型;
– -i:显示索引节点的使用情况而非磁盘空间;
– -a:显示所有文件系统,包括系统保留的文件系统;
– -x:排除指定的文件系统类型;
– -l:仅显示本地文件系统;
– -P:以POSIX兼容格式输出,每行一个文件系统;如果不指定文件或目录,则默认显示所有已挂载的文件系统的使用情况。
下面是一些常用的df命令示例:
1. 显示所有挂载的文件系统的空间使用情况(以人类可读的方式):
“`
df -h
“`2. 显示指定目录的磁盘空间使用情况:
“`
df /path/to/directory
“`3. 只显示本地文件系统的空间使用情况:
“`
df -l
“`4. 显示指定文件系统类型的空间使用情况:
“`
df -t ext4
“`5. 显示指定文件系统类型以外的空间使用情况:
“`
df -x ext4
“`通过使用df命令,你可以快速了解Linux系统中各个文件系统的空间使用情况,帮助你管理和优化磁盘空间。
2年前 -
df命令是linux用于查看文件系统磁盘空间利用率的常用命令。下面是关于df命令的五个重要点:
1. 基本语法:
df命令的基本语法为:df [选项] [文件名/目录]。不带选项和文件名/目录参数时,默认显示所有已挂载的文件系统的磁盘空间利用率。
一些常用选项包括:
-h: 以易读的格式输出磁盘空间大小,使用K、M、G等单位表示。
-T: 显示文件系统的类型。
-k: 使用1024字节为单位输出磁盘空间大小。
-i: 显示inode的使用情况。
-x: 不显示指定文件系统类型的磁盘空间利用率。2. 查看所有已挂载文件系统:
在不带选项和文件名/目录参数的情况下,直接输入df命令即可查看所有已挂载的文件系统的磁盘空间利用率。
输出结果包括:文件系统名称、总空间大小、已使用大小、可用大小、已用百分比和挂载点。3. 查看指定文件系统:
可以通过提供文件名或目录作为命令参数来只查看与该文件名或目录相关的文件系统的磁盘空间利用率。
例如,输入df /home命令可以查看/home目录所在的文件系统的磁盘空间利用率。4. 显示易读的磁盘空间大小:
使用-h选项可以以易读的格式输出磁盘空间大小,通过使用K、M、G等单位,更加直观地显示磁盘空间占用情况。
例如,df -h命令显示的结果中,文件系统的总空间、已使用大小和可用大小以K、M、G等单位表示。5. 显示文件系统类型:
使用-T选项可以显示文件系统的类型。默认情况下,df命令不会显示文件系统类型。
例如,df -T命令可以显示文件系统类型,如ext4、ntfs等。这对于排查磁盘空间问题时,能够更准确地确定文件系统类型。2年前 -
Linux中可以使用`df`命令来查看系统中已经挂载的文件系统的相关信息,包括文件系统的挂载点、可用空间、已用空间、使用百分比以及文件系统的类型等。
下面是`df`命令的常用参数和示例:
1. `df -h`:以人类可读的方式显示文件系统的磁盘空间信息。
示例输出:
“`
Filesystem Size Used Avail Use% Mounted on
/dev/sda1 20G 5.5G 14G 30% /
tmpfs 396M 0 396M 0% /dev/shm
/dev/sdb1 1.5T 486G 995G 33% /data
“`2. `df -T`:显示文件系统的类型。
示例输出:
“`
Filesystem Type 1K-blocks Used Available Use% Mounted on
/dev/sda1 ext4 20971520 5505024 15466576 30% /
tmpfs tmpfs 405332 0 405332 0% /dev/shm
/dev/sdb1 xfs 1600866544 52428648 1548437896 4% /data
“`3. `df -i`:显示文件系统的inode使用情况。
示例输出:
“`
Filesystem Inodes IUsed IFree IUse% Mounted on
/dev/sda1 1310720 147105 1163615 12% /
tmpfs 101333 2 101331 1% /dev/shm
/dev/sdb1 8388608 19046 8379562 1% /data
“`4. `df -a`:显示所有文件系统的信息(包括虚拟文件系统)。
示例输出:
“`
Filesystem 1K-blocks Used Available Use% Mounted on
sysfs 0 0 0 – /sys
proc 0 0 0 – /proc
udev 0 0 0 – /dev
devpts 0 0 0 – /dev/pts
tmpfs 405332 0 405332 0% /dev/shm
/dev/sda1 20971520 5504860 15466640 30% /
none 0 0 0 – /sys/fs/cgroup
systemd-1 0 0 0 – /proc/sys/fs/binfmt_misc
debugfs 0 0 0 – /sys/kernel/debug
securityfs 0 0 0 – /sys/kernel/security
hugetlbfs 0 0 0 – /dev/hugepages
mqueue 0 0 0 – /dev/mqueue
/dev/sdb1 1600866544 52424160 1548442384 4% /data
tracefs 0 0 0 – /sys/kernel/tracing
fusectl 0 0 0 – /sys/fs/fuse/connections
tmpfs 405332 0 405332 0% /run/user/1000
“`5. `df -x`:排除指定文件系统类型。
示例输出:
“`
Filesystem 1K-blocks Used Available Use% Mounted on
/dev/sda1 20971520 5504340 15467160 30% /
tmpfs 405332 0 405332 0% /dev/shm
/dev/sdb1 1600866544 52424160 1548442384 4% /data
“`6. `df -P`:以POSIX标准输出而非POSIX兼容方式输出。
示例输出:
“`
Filesystem 1024-blocks Used Available Capacity Mounted on
/dev/sda1 20480 5504 15472 30% /
tmpfs 198144 0 198144 0% /dev/shm
/dev/sdb1 1563308 12832 1470476 1% /data
“`除了上述参数,`df`命令还有其他一些参数可用,可以使用`man df`命令查看更多详细的用法说明。
2年前